The Offer

Direct link to offer

  • Reliant Bank is offering a bonus of $200 when you open a new free checking account and complete the following requirements:
    • Have an opening deposit of at least $500
    • Receive a qualifying direct deposit first full statement cycle
    • Have 10 settled debit card transactions on the first full statement cycle
    • Maintain a positive account balance for 90 days

The Fine Print

  • This offer is limited to one per household and is not available to existing Reliant Bank checking customers.
  • To receive bonus, you must open your account at a Reliant Bank branch and present a copy of this offer certificate.
  • To qualify for the bonus, you must have an opening deposit of at least $500 (dollars must be new money, i.e. funds not previously on deposit at Reliant in the last six months), at least one qualifying direct deposit1 posted to your account, and 10 settled debit card transactions (not including ATM transactions) on the first full statement cycle.
  • You must also maintain a positive account balance for 90 days.
  • If you meet the stated requirements of this promotional offer, the bonus will be deposited to your account on the first business day after the account has been open for 90 days and will be reported as income on Form 1099-INT.
  • This offer is subject to change without notice and may be withdrawn at any time.
  • Accounts are subject to approval.
  • A qualifying direct deposit is an electronic credit to your account of your salary, pension, Social Security or other regular monthly income deposited to your account by your employer or an outside agency.
  • Transfers from one account to another or deposits made at a banking location or ATM do not qualify as a direct deposit.
